A stone thrown upwards, has its equation of motion s=490 t-4.9 t^2 . Then the maximum height reached by it, is
Options
- A24500
- B12500
- C12250
- D25400
Correct answer
C. 12250
Step-by-step solution
Given that s=490 t-4.9 t^2 On differentiating w.r.t. t , we get d s d t =490-9.8 t A stone is reached the maximum height, when d s d t =0 array cc & 490-9.8 t=0 & t= 490 9.8 = 100 2 =50 array Maximum height at t=50 aligned s & =490(50)-4.9(50)^2 & =24500-12250 & =12250 aligned
